The Turbo Shell Sheet (24 x 14 cm) is a remarkable material crafted from the natural shells of large sea snails, known as Turbo or Turban Shells. Celebrated for their vibrant nacre, or Mother of Pearl, these shells have a long-standing history of use in decorative arts and craftsmanship due to their stunning color and iridescence. Our thin veneers are specifically designed for modern applications, offering an elegant yet cost-effective alternative to traditional abalone inlays.
These sheets are particularly suited for reverse glass applications, as seen in specialist signwriting, or for adding striking accents to the backs of glass. Their versatility extends to surface finishing and decorative projects, making them a popular choice for industries such as yacht design, luxury hotels, and high-end interiors. Each sheet is meticulously handmade from ethically sourced turbo shell strips, which are thinly sawn, color-matched, and bound together with epoxy. While the sheets maintain a pleasing uniformity, slight variations in color and texture reflect the natural origin of the material.
The iridescent qualities of Turbo Shell Sheets make them highly dynamic, with their visual appearance shifting depending on lighting and viewing angle.
